Donnelly Lakes is a 40 hectare former farming property, surrounded by state forests.

       

Flood plains May-November

As a registered member of Land for Wildlife we take our responsibility in respecting the unique natural beauty of Donnelly Lakes seriously. The property is a showcase for native flora and fauna.

The main lake in front of the chalets is 2 hectares (5 acres) in size. For 7 months of the year it is connected through streams to 3 other lakes on the property forming a unique waterway.

 

The interpretative self-guided bush walk with 25 stations allows our guests to explore the banks of the bordering Donnelly River with the delicate maidenhair fern, corky-barked casuarina,  and moss-covered logs, the lakes, flood plains and forest.

Late in the winter the river may burst its banks flooding the lower paddocks providing a playground for many water birds. The bird-viewing hide over the second lake is a perfect place to view nature at its best.

We understand that many of our guests are keen bird watchers. (Don't forget to bring your binoculars!) Since 1999, we have been surveying the birds at Donnelly Lakes. We ask any budding ornithologists to help us in this by recording any bird sightings on the property.

The upper paddock is a favourite meeting place for mobs of kangaroos which tend to graze from late afternoon. The kangaroo viewing hide is designed to allow guests the opportunity to observe these iconic marsupials in their natural habitat. Alternatively, ask to borrow the spotlight so you may view them from your car at night.

 

The sand plains of Donnelly Lakes are home to an array of native orchids and wild flowers. This glorious display can be seen between September and November.
